热门开源项目ChatTTS:国内AI语音技术新标杆,引领全球创新浪潮
2025.09.23 12:08浏览量:4简介:国内开源项目ChatTTS凭借技术创新与生态共建,在语音合成领域实现技术突破,推动全球语音技术格局重塑,为开发者与企业提供高效、灵活的解决方案。
一、技术突破:ChatTTS如何重构语音合成边界?
1.1 端到端架构的颠覆性创新
ChatTTS采用基于Transformer的端到端(End-to-End)架构,彻底摒弃传统语音合成中“文本分析-声学模型-声码器”的分段式设计。其核心优势在于:
- 全局上下文建模:通过自注意力机制(Self-Attention)捕捉文本与语音的跨模态关联,例如在合成“他带着微笑说”时,模型能同时感知“微笑”的语义与声调的轻柔变化。
- 动态韵律控制:引入隐变量(Latent Variable)机制,允许用户通过参数调节语音的节奏、重音和情感强度。例如,输入
<prosody rate="slow" pitch="+2st">即可生成缓慢且音调上扬的语音。 - 低资源适应性:在仅10小时标注数据的条件下,ChatTTS的词错率(WER)较传统模型降低37%,为小语种和垂直领域应用提供可能。
1.2 多模态交互的深度融合
ChatTTS创新性地将语音合成与视觉、文本信息结合,支持以下场景:
- 唇形同步(Lip Sync):通过输入视频帧序列,模型可生成与口型精确匹配的语音,误差小于50ms,适用于虚拟主播和影视配音。
- 情感增强合成:结合文本情感分析(如BERT模型),自动调整语音的能量、语速和基频。例如,将“太棒了!”合成为兴奋的语调,而“哦,不…”则转为低沉的语气。
- 实时交互优化:在流式合成场景下,通过增量解码(Incremental Decoding)将延迟控制在200ms以内,满足在线客服和智能助手的实时需求。
二、开源生态:从技术到产业的全面赋能
2.1 代码与模型的完全开放
ChatTTS在GitHub上开源了核心代码(MIT协议)和预训练模型(含中英文),开发者可自由使用、修改和分发。其技术文档涵盖:
- 模型训练指南:详细说明数据预处理(如文本归一化、音素对齐)、超参数配置(学习率、批次大小)和分布式训练技巧。
- 部署教程:提供Docker镜像和ONNX导出方案,支持在CPU/GPU/NPU上部署,推理速度较同类模型提升2.3倍。
- API接口规范:定义RESTful API和WebSocket协议,便于与现有系统集成。
2.2 开发者工具链的完善
项目配套开发了以下工具:
- ChatTTS Studio:可视化调试平台,支持语音合成参数实时调整和效果对比。
- 插件市场:集成语音变声、背景音消除等扩展功能,开发者可上传自定义插件。
- 性能评测套件:包含客观指标(如MOS评分、合成速度)和主观听测模板,帮助优化模型质量。
三、产业应用:从实验室到商业场景的落地
3.1 智能客服的效率革命
某头部电商平台接入ChatTTS后,实现以下优化:
- 多轮对话支持:通过上下文感知,将客户问题理解准确率从82%提升至95%。
- 个性化语音定制:为不同品牌定制专属语音风格(如年轻化、权威感),客户满意度提高18%。
- 成本降低:单次合成成本从0.03元降至0.008元,年节省费用超千万元。
3.2 教育领域的创新实践
在线教育平台利用ChatTTS开发了:
- AI口语教练:实时纠正发音并生成反馈语音,学生互动时长增加40%。
- 多语言学习:支持中英日韩等20种语言的合成,覆盖90%的学习需求。
- 无障碍教育:为视障学生生成带情感描述的语音教材,使用率达75%。
四、开发者指南:如何快速上手ChatTTS?
4.1 环境配置
# 使用conda创建环境conda create -n chatts python=3.9conda activate chatts# 安装依赖pip install torch transformers librosagit clone https://github.com/your-repo/ChatTTS.gitcd ChatTTSpip install -e .
4.2 基础合成示例
from chatts import Synthesizer# 加载模型synthesizer = Synthesizer.from_pretrained("chatts-base")# 合成语音audio = synthesizer.synthesize(text="ChatTTS正在改变语音技术的未来",speaker_id=0, # 默认说话人prosody_params={"rate": 1.0, "pitch": 0} # 韵律参数)# 保存音频import soundfile as sfsf.write("output.wav", audio, synthesizer.sample_rate)
4.3 进阶优化技巧
- 数据增强:通过添加背景噪音或调整语速训练鲁棒模型。
- 模型微调:在垂直领域数据(如医疗、法律)上继续训练,提升专业术语合成质量。
- 硬件加速:使用TensorRT或Intel OpenVINO优化推理速度。
五、未来展望:ChatTTS的全球影响力
ChatTTS的开源不仅推动了国内语音技术的发展,更在全球范围内引发连锁反应:
- 学术影响:相关论文被ICASSP、Interspeech等顶级会议收录,引用量超500次。
- 产业联动:与芯片厂商合作优化硬件适配,与云服务提供商共建语音合成平台。
- 标准制定:参与ISO/IEC语音合成标准制定,提升中国技术话语权。
作为国内语音技术的里程碑,ChatTTS通过技术创新、开源生态和产业落地,实现了从“跟跑”到“并跑”乃至“领跑”的跨越。对于开发者而言,它不仅是工具,更是探索语音技术边界的钥匙;对于企业,它是降本增效、提升用户体验的利器。未来,随着多模态大模型的融合,ChatTTS有望开启更广阔的智能交互时代。

发表评论
登录后可评论,请前往 登录 或 注册